When you look at electric fireplaces, the final cost depends on a few specific things. Size is the biggest factor, as larger units require more materials and complex internal heating components. You will also see price shifts based on the installation type—built-in models involve more labor and structural work than simple wall-mount options. Features like realistic flame technology, smart home integration, and heat output settings also change the bottom line. We can get your exact pricing confirmed free on the call.
Believe it or not, summer is a great time to use your fireplace. Since the heating element can be turned off completely, you get to enjoy the ambiance of a flickering fire without adding any warmth to your home. It acts as a sophisticated focal point for your living space during evening gatherings.
The main limitation is that electric fireplaces primarily offer supplemental heat, not enough to be the sole heating source for a large Fort Wayne home. While modern flame effects are very convincing, they won't replicate the authentic crackle and warmth of a real wood fire. Safety and ease of use are major advantages, however.
When only the flame effect is on, they use very little electricity, similar to a lamp. When the heater is active, they consume more, but are often more efficient for heating a single room than your central heating system. Most models in Fort Wayne can plug into a standard outlet.
Yes, for many residents of Fort Wayne, they are an excellent idea. They provide immediate ambiance, supplemental heat, and are incredibly safe and easy to operate. They're a perfect way to add a cozy focal point to a living room or bedroom without the complexities of gas or wood-burning fireplaces.
The most realistic electric fireplaces utilize advanced LED technology for dynamic, multi-colored flame effects with adjustable speeds. Many also feature highly detailed log sets and ember beds that mimic real fire. The pros serving Fort Wayne can guide you to the best options available.
An electric fireplace insert is a fantastic solution for updating an existing fireplace in Fort Wayne. It offers the aesthetic of a fireplace with the convenience of electric heat and ambiance, without requiring major structural changes. It's a simple, effective way to modernize your home.
Yes, most electric fireplaces are designed to plug into a standard 120-volt outlet, making installation straightforward for Fort Wayne homeowners. This convenience means you can enjoy your new fireplace without the need for special electrical work.
